
Cells specialized even more than sponges and tissues (groups of similar cells) began with the cnidarians family. Nerves and muscles first appear in these animals, although they had no brain. Their behavior is very simple, responding automatically to touch. Nerves can carry more information between cells than hormones can. Nerves are the main feature which makes animals different from plants. Cnidarians might have evolved into flatworms.
Cnidarians might have appeared 650 million years ago. They belong to the group of animals called Cnidaria or Coelenterata. This group includes corals, hydras, jellyfish, Portuguese men-of-war, sea anemones, sea pens, sea whips, and sea fans.
